Puff pastry rises, cooks quickly and is wonderfully tender and crispy - ideal for use as a base for quiches or filled pockets. To do this, the savory or sweet filling is placed on one half of the dough, the other half is folded over it and then both sides are pressed down.

At the moment, however, social media such as Instagram or TikTok are increasingly showing a method of preparation that turns everything upside down. And literally: Because in this variant, the ingredients are first placed on the tray and the puff pastry is placed over it like a blanket. Once everything is baked, the "Upside Down Pastries", i.e. the upside-down dumplings, are caramelized and juicy on one side and nice and brown and crispy on the other.

Ingredients:

  • 0.5 l vanilla pudding (prepared according to package instructions or homemade)
  • 300-400 g rhubarb (or fruits of choice, e.g. pears)
  • 1 pack of puff pastry (frozen, alternatively: fresh food counter)
  • Honey
  • 100 g almonds (chopped)
  • Cinnamon sugar to taste

In her TikTok video, Doris demonstrates how to prepare it:

  • Cook the pudding according to the instructions. Meanwhile, peel the rhubarb and cut into small pieces.
  • Once the pudding has thickened, add the rhubarb and let it cook for about two minutes. Always stir, otherwise it will burn. After that, remove from the heat. Preheat oven to 200 degrees.
  • If frozen puff pastry: Take it out and cut the individual portions in half and let them thaw slightly
  • Prepare the baking tray and line it with baking paper, for example. Pour honey directly onto the baking sheet, about 1 tbsp per puff pastry pocket. Add almonds (about 1 tbsp) and the custard-rhubarb mixture (about 1-2 tbsp).
  • Place the puff pastry on the piles like a blanket and then press firmly against the tray with a fork all around. The goal here is to ensure that nothing leaks.
  • Then bake at about 200 degrees top/bottom heat (180 degrees convection) for 20 minutes in the preheated oven.
